Hello Heroes!
We encourage you to continue on this journey of getting healthy! CEO John Stenacker has been offering some winning advice and motivation through knowledge to keep us all in the fight for better health.
I'd like to give you some advice too, especially if you're struggling with weight loss, because years and years ago I was there! I was once 240 lbs at 5'10" tall and that was not very healthy. Today I'm about 162 lbs and I've kept it off with some simple steps.
-
Don't eat out of a box -- pre-packaged foods and snacks are loaded with chemicals and preservatives that you don't want or need. You can allow yourself to still eat foods you "love" but use some common sense. If you love Kraft Macaroni and Cheese find a recipe for FRESH Macaroni and Cheese you make yourself using the best ingredients you can afford. I personally like to buy fresh made pasta from a local market and I use an organic cheese.
-
Understand Portions -- your eyes are always bigger than your stomach-- resist the urge to overeat-- that was the biggest thing that snapped for me. I hated feeling so full I couldn't walk, so I made the decision to use smaller plates and bowls, eat slower by putting your utensils down between bites and chew your food very thoroughly. Have water with your meal. No TV-- just focus on eating slow and enjoying every bite of this new smaller portion. If you're still hungry WAIT before getting seconds, sometimes our brains need time to catch up.
-
Keep a snack journal -- My wife makes the best chocolate chip cookies I've ever had. I thought I was eating 1-2 a day-- by writing it down I soon realized it was a lot more than that. The snack journal was a real eye-opener and just knowing I had to write something down made me less likely to snack at all. I also found a type of apple I really liked and that became a go to snack food for me.
-
Take a walk after dinner -- 20-30 mins is ideal, you don't have to break any speed records, just get up and move. If 20 mins is too much, start lower and
work your way up.
- Don't give up -- That's the most important thing. You'll find when you change your diet and start exercising that the weight seems like its falling off -- then it slows down and almost stops -- that's normal! Keep at it and your metabolism will eventually burn more calories again.
Just remember, You Can Do It!
